参考文档:https://docs.spring.io/spring-boot/docs/2.2.2.RELEASE/reference/html/spring-boot-features.html#boot-features-developing-web-applicationsSpringMvc自动配置原理Spring Boot为Spring MVC提供了自动配置,可与大多数应用程序完美配合。
# MySQL视图:显示指定类型 ## 引言 MySQL是一种流行的关系型数据库管理系统,它提供了许多功能和工具来处理和管理数据。其中之一是视图,它是一个虚拟表,从一个或多个基本表中派生并根据需要进行计算。视图可以简化数据访问,并提供更高级别的数据抽象。在本文中,我们将探讨如何在MySQL中创建和使用视图,并了解如何显示指定类型视图。 ## 什么是视图视图是一个虚拟表,它包含从一个或
原创 2023-08-23 06:35:21
147阅读
相信很多人都会错按键导致我们的springboot项目多视图窗口不见了,然后找半天找不到
原创 2021-12-23 16:41:22
213阅读
# Python指定返回多个类型 在Python中,函数通常只能返回一个数据类型。但是有时候我们希望函数能够根据某些条件返回不同的数据类型。这时,我们可以使用一些技巧来实现这个目标,让函数能够返回多个类型的值。 ## 多态 在面向对象编程中,多态是一种对象的多种形态的表现。在Python中,多态性是一种特性,它允许不同类的对象对同一个方法做出不同的响应。这种多态性使得我们可以根据不同的条件返
原创 2024-07-03 03:56:57
44阅读
目录前言一、视图的作用二、定义视图三、查询视图四、更新视图总结前言视图是从一个或多个基本表导出的视图,数据库中只存放视图的定义,而不存在视图对应的数据,这些数据仍然存储在对应的基本表中,当基本表中的数据发生变换时,视图中查询的数据也随之变化,视图相当于一个窗口,透过它可以看到数据库中使用者感兴趣的数据及其变化。一、视图的作用1)视图能够简化用户操作2)视图使用户能够以多种角度看待同一数据3)视图
转载 2023-06-04 18:31:39
136阅读
## MySQL创建视图的时候指定类型 ### 引言 在MySQL中,视图是一个虚拟表,它基于查询的结果集而创建。创建视图可以简化复杂的查询操作,并提高查询效率。MySQL可以创建不同类型视图,包括普通视图、临时视图和物化视图。本文将介绍如何在创建视图指定不同类型,并提供相应的代码示例。 ### 普通视图 普通视图是最常见的视图类型,它是基于一个或多个表的查询结果创建的。普通视图不会存
原创 2023-08-11 18:16:51
253阅读
# MySQL视图指定数据类型实现流程 ## 简介 在MySQL中,视图是一种虚拟表,其内容是从一个或多个表中检索出来的。视图可以简化复杂的查询操作,还可以隐藏敏感数据。本文将介绍如何在MySQL中创建视图指定数据类型。 ## 创建视图的步骤 | 步骤 | 操作 | | ---- | ---- | | 1 | 创建原始表 | | 2 | 插入数据到原始表 | | 3 | 创建视图 | |
原创 2023-08-10 08:07:54
239阅读
一、注解说明  在spring-boot+spring mvc 的项目中,有些时候我们需要自己配置一些项目的设置,就会涉及到这三个,那么,他们之间有什么关系呢? 首先,@EnableWebMvc=WebMvcConfigurationSupport,使用了@EnableWebMvc注解等于扩展了WebMvcConfigurationSupport但是没有重写任何方法。所以有以下几种使用方
转载 2024-04-03 13:49:04
86阅读
1.简介 在Spring中,提供了View Resolver来使用模型中可用的数据来解析视图,而无需与JSP,Velocity或Thymeleaf等View技术紧密绑定。 Spring可以根据需要轻松灵活地配置一个或多个View Resolver 。 2. Spring MVC应用程序流程 在继续理解多个View Resolver如何实现此目的之前, 传入的请求通过web.xml , 调度程
转载 2024-05-29 10:48:27
177阅读
# Python返回多个指定类型 ## 引言 作为一名经验丰富的开发者,我们经常需要在Python中实现返回多个值,并且需要指定返回值的类型。本文将教你如何实现这一目标,特别是对于刚入行的小白来说,这是一个非常重要的技能。 ## 流程 首先,让我们看一下整个过程的流程。我们可以用一个简单的表格来展示。 ```mermaid journey title 返回多个指定类型的流程
原创 2024-07-09 05:48:27
66阅读
# Python函数参数指定多个类型的入门指南 在Python中,函数参数的类型指定是一个非常重要的话题。它可以帮助我们更好地理解函数的使用方式,同时也能提升代码的可读性与维护性。对于初学者来说,掌握如何为函数参数指定多个类型是非常必要的。本文将引导你完成这一学习过程。 ## 流程概述 实现“Python函数参数指定多个类型”的过程可以分为以下几个步骤: | 步骤 | 描述
原创 2024-08-08 15:38:36
389阅读
# 如何在 Python 中实现函数参数的多类型指定 在 Python 中,函数的参数可以有多种类型,这种灵活性使得 Python 成为一种非常强大的编程语言。但当你刚入门时,可能会对如何指定函数参数的多种类型感到困惑。在这篇文章中,我们将逐步指导你如何实现这一目标。 ## 流程概览 首先,让我们来看一下实现步骤的概览: | 步骤 | 动作 | 描述 | |------|------|--
原创 2024-09-20 14:25:09
257阅读
今天创建一个视图create view v_myview{   id,   time}asselect t.id as id,    (case          when to_date(t.time,'hh24:mi:ss')<       &nbsp
原创 2013-05-30 17:54:39
4293阅读
在实际的项目开发中,一个项目通常会存在多个环境,例如,开发环境、测试环境和生产环境等。不同环境的配置也不尽相同,例如开发环境使用的是开发数据库,测试环境使用的是测试数据库,而生产环境使用的是线上的正式数据库。 Profile 为在不同环境下使用不同的配置提供了支持,我们可以通过激活、指定参数等方式快速切换环境。多 Profile 文件方式Spring Boot 的配置文件共有两种形式:.prope
  视图是一个存在于数据库中的虚拟表。视图本身没有数据,只是通过执行相应的select语句完成获得相应的数据。可以理解为select语句的别名。(1).视图的作用  1.如果某个查询结果出现的非常频繁,即将这个查询结果作为子查询使用,视图能够简化用户的操作(简单性)  2.对数据提供安全保护(安全性)  3.对重构的数据库提供一定的逻辑性(逻辑数据独立性)(2).创建视图  创建实验环境:mysq
作者:木木匠 我们知道 Spring Boot 给我们带来了一个全新的开发体验,让我们可以直接把 Web 程序打包成 jar 包直接启动,这得益于 Spring Boot 内置了容器,可以直接启动。 本文将以 Tomcat 为例,来看看 Spring Boot 是如何启动 Tomcat 的,同时也将展开学习下 Tomcat 的源码,了解 Tomcat 的设计。 从
转载 2023-08-29 18:08:29
118阅读
一. 视图概述视图是一个虚拟表,其内容由查询定义。同真实的表一样,视图包含一系列带有名称的列和行数据。但是,视图并不在数据库中以存储的数据值集形式存在。行和列数据来自由定义视图的查询所引用的表,并且在引用视图时动态生成。对其中所引用的基础表来说,视图的作用类似于筛选。定义视图的筛选可以来自当前或其它数据库的一个或多个表,或者其它视图。通过视图进行查询没有任何限制,通过它们进行数据修改时的限制也很少
本来在创建了表单之后应该是表单列表和预览功能。可是我看了看整合的代码,和之前没实用angularjs的基本没有什么变化,一些极小的变动也仅仅是基于angularjs的语法,因此全然能够參考之前说些的表单列表展示相关的内容,这里也就直接进入到下一个步骤,创建流程模型了。 在之前的创建流程模型一节里,我讲代码比較多,实际上在这里还有非常重要的一个环节没有细说,那就是自己定义流程图,画流程图的
 1.视图视图类似一张表,这张表的数据来源是数据库的表中的数据例子:作用1:提高重用性。创建视图:mmpcreate view mmp as select a.*,b.aopsc_id from v2_b_payment_conf a left join v2_b_r_payment b on a.id=b.aopsc_id;使用视图:select * from mmp;作用2:对数据
Springboot中自定义返回数据的格式。1.统一返回的格式其中返回的内容有status状态码、message返回信息、data数据、timestamp时间戳@Data public class ResultData<T> { /** 结果状态 ,具体状态码参见ResultData.java*/ private int status; private Str
转载 2024-06-25 16:30:37
211阅读
  • 1
  • 2
  • 3
  • 4
  • 5